Original Description
The Toast by Severin Roesen (c. 1860) is a vibrant celebration of abundance, shimmering with the luscious textures of ripe fruit, delicate glassware, and a sumptuous grape cluster tumbling toward the viewer’s gaze. A master of still life in the Hudson River School tradition, Roesen’s meticulous realism reflects mid-19th-century America’s fascination with natural bounty and opulent domesticity. The composition teems with symbolism—grapes and wine suggest conviviality, while the fragility of the tipped glass adds a hint of transience, echoing Dutch vanitas traditions. Historically, Roesen’s works bridged European still-life techniques with American optimism, earning him acclaim as a key figure in the genre. His layered textures and radiant light effects elevate The Toast beyond mere decoration, placing it among the finest examples of Victorian-era still lifes.
